While wandering through an estate sale, our designer discovered a vintage printer’s cabinet in the basement. Pieces of metal type were still stored in its 26 drawers, with each dedicated to a different font. This handsome armoire captures the symmetry of the original design, with bluff cut doors that are artfully detailed to resemble many small drawers.
